Maryland Code § CP-11-1010

Section CP-11-1010

(a) In this section, "person in interest" has the meaning stated in § 4-101 of
the General Provisions Article.
(b) This section applies only with respect to a victim whose initial
determination of cause or manner of death recorded on the victim's death certificate
under § 4-212 of the Health - General Article was amended or corrected to be
undetermined or homicide under § 5-309(d)(2) of the Health - General Article.

(c) For an investigation or a case involving a victim described under
subsection (b) of this section, an assistant State's Attorney with knowledge of the case
shall meet with a person in interest within 20 days after receiving a request from the
person in interest to meet regarding the person in interest's request that the Office
of the State's Attorney pursue an investigation into the circumstances of the victim's
death.
(d) At the meeting required under this section, the assistant State's
Attorney shall explain the justification for not pursuing an investigation into the
victim's death despite the amendment or correction to the cause or manner of death
on the death certificate of the victim.
(e) The meeting required under this section may be conducted in person, by
telephone, or by other means mutually agreed on.
